Further Information About PERKS Henry Charles
Served in the Great War.
Henry Charles Perks was born in Beckford in 1881. Served as Private 662472, Labour Corps, formerly Private 41724, Royal Berkshire Regiment. He was awarded the British War Medal and the Victory Medal.
Henry Perks enlisted in the army on the 25th November 1915 when he gave his age as 34 years, his occupation as a Gardener and his address as Council Cottage, Beckford, Gloucestershire. His next of kin was his wife Louisa Ann Perks nee Coombes who he had married on the 25th November 1911 at Trinity Church, Tewkesbury. Their daughter Daisy Annie was born on the 19th February 1912.
